Bula FC delivered a commanding performance in the first half, securing a 2-1 victory against PNG Hekari FC in Round 3 of the OFC Pro League. Right from the outset, Bula FC showcased their determination to dominate, exhibiting impressive sharpness and control on the pitch.
The opening goal arrived in the 11th minute when Filipe Baravilala made a significant impact on the right flank. His pinpoint cross found Fergus Gillion, who expertly set up Thomas Dunn for a close-range finish. After a thorough VAR review to check for offside, the goal was confirmed, underscoring Bula’s early prowess.
Bula FC extended their lead in the 35th minute through a rapid counterattack. Following a defensive stand against a PNG Hekari free kick, Kaile Auvray demonstrated remarkable pace as he navigated past a defender and calmly placed a low shot into the near post, leaving goalkeeper Dave Tomare with no chance.
In response, PNG Hekari found the net just before halftime with a strike from Ati Kepo, but Bula’s strong first-half showing allowed them to maintain their lead going into the break.
The second half saw a shift in momentum, with PNG Hekari increasing their possession and applying pressure. However, Bula FC’s defense held firm, overcoming injury challenges to see the match through to its conclusion. Head coach Stephane Auvray reflected positively on the match, particularly praising the first half. He noted, “We should have scored one more to make the game easier for us. The second half wasn’t as impressive, so we still have work to do. I’m very happy for the players because they’ve been working hard, but tomorrow we get back to work.”
Auvray also emphasized the club’s focus on integrating young talent into their strategy, mentioning 18-year-old Ibraheem, who played as a left winger, and 20-year-old Ayman, who showed growth as a left central back during the match. “It was a difficult start for Ayman, but he became more comfortable as the game progressed. I’m happy for them,” he remarked.
